Recently, within an apparent response to the largely-flawed critique of stablecoins from the Open up Markets Institute, cryptocurrency trade FTX clarified its place on transaction costs for withdrawals.
Its post was striking for the reason that it seemed to associate proof-of-function (PoW) blockchains with higher fees (which customers are partly in charge of upon withdrawal) and proof-of-stake (PoS) blockchains with reduced fees. The final outcome: FTX really wants to encourage customers to utilize low-fee, less-energy-intensive, proof-of-stake blockchains. We are able to see the selling point of associating PoW with extractive, consumer-unfriendly, high charges, and PoS with effectiveness and user-friendliness. But FTX will be mistaken to associate consensus and costs.
In its content, FTX claimed:
The specific amount a blockchain requires to deliver a deal differs widely in line with the underlying structure of this blockchain. Systems like Bitcoin and Ethereum are usually known as Proof Work blockchains, where in fact the work necessary to add that deal to the blockchain runs on the massive amount computing hard work. On such platforms, typical transaction fees are very higher: around $2 per deal for Bitcoin, and around $40 per deal on Ethereum!
Leaving apart our surprise at viewing a significant exchange take this type of partisan approach, the evaluation uses misconception regarding the connection between consensus (or even Sybil resistance) strategies and blockchain costs. There simply is not any inherent association between proof work and high costs, or proof stake and low costs. The fact that the only real meaningful costs can be found on two blockchains (Ethereum and Bitcoin), both which currently are actually PoW-based, does not imply that PoW implies or leads to costs. It simply implies that the two hottest blockchains both make use of PoW and so are somewhat congested, resulting in high fees (Ethereum, way more than Bitcoin).
In PoW coins, function must be carried out and verified before a block is usually appended to a blockchain. Producing function requires miners to execute several attempts before locating the amount that grants them authorization by the process to include a block to the blockchain. Initially, it could appear that proof works trial-and-error architecture normally involves a delay in block creation and that, in situations of congestion, that delay pushes charges higher. However, it is a misunderstanding of what drives throughput.
Enough time inside between blocks isn’t what determines throughput inside crypto networks. Rather, the primary determinant of throughput will be block dimension, i.e., the amount of bytes (and therefore, transactions) that can match a block. Consider a blockchain designed to generate one block per 2nd with 1,000 dealings in each block gets the exact same throughput of a blockchain that creates one block each and every minute that’s large enough to match 60,000 dealings.
Critics of proof work may be tempted to declare that a rise in the interval between blocks impacts settlement time, which increases congestion. That could furthermore be misguided. A deal contained in a block isn’t last. All blockchains, including the ones that follow brand-new architectures such as for example Solana, require customers to hold back before considering a deal final. The real reason for this wait will be that we now have events that might happen within that time period where in fact the blocks in the blockchain are usually reorganized. Based on the severity of the events, a deal that was as soon as in a block may be permanently taken off the blockchain.
Fees CERTAINLY ARE A Function Of Source And Demand
The reason for fees is merely more need for blockspace than there’s available supply. Under problems of scarcity, a prioritization way for transactions should be determined. One method is to make an auction where eager transactors pays up for priority inclusion in a block.
Getting material fees is incredibly healthy for a general public blockchain program: it eliminates the spam issue by rendering it costly to put in junk data, also it constitutes protocol income which can be directed to several causes.
In Bitcoins situation, this fee-based revenue can pay for security as soon as issuance trails off. For Ethereum, fees already are getting burnt to introduce a deflationary mechanic. You might redirect fees to financing various public products like paying Primary developers. To create a rough business analogy, fees are income and issued source is equity. Many companies do finance their procedures by continually issuing share, but shareholders usually prefer not to obtain endlessly diluted. The living of fee income frees blockchains from reliance on dilution-based financing.
Such blockchains, fees also have fun with a critical role inside supporting their long-term protection. They ensure it is costly for details to be kept on the blockchain, therefore disincentivizing spam and DDoS assaults which have historically plagued zero-/low-fee systems, like Nano, EOS and XRP. Most crucially, charges promote a competitive atmosphere among miners which helps it be prohibitively expensive for individual parties to successfully strike a network. So far, proof work in high-fee conditions may be the only battle-tested system known to the to end up being resilient against episodes.
In its post, FTX claimed that the task necessary to add [a] deal to the blockchain runs on the massive amount computing hard work. This is erroneous. Unlike this typical characterization of PoW, there is absolutely no energy payload necessary to make a deal. You aren’t using joules to press dealings through the pipes. Producing, registering and validating a deal costs hardly any, computationally.
Finished . that is expensive (financially, and, regarding PoW, with regards to energy, as well) is earning the eligibility rights to add a block, obtainable by brute-forcing for a valid nonce. And its own expensive as the reward for developing a block is substantial around $290,000 during this composing. Logically, miners can pay around $99 to earn a bounty worthy of $100. But this bounty is present because of the issuance of fresh coins as charges are usually de minimis (in Bitcoin at the very least). The bounty can be offered whether a block consists of 4,000 dealings or none.
The per-transaction energy cost shape that FTX and the affiliated Solana create frequent mention of is not a good analysis. Bitcoin could make far more blockspace, hence driving costs to zero (as BSV do indeed do, for example), without expending a joule even more energy. Bitcoin may possibly also process zero dealings per block, and miners would expend virtually exactly the same level of energy. There just isnt a linear correlation between dealings and power expenditure, and there’s hardly any causal linkage between your two.
Why Control Block Space?
As to the reasons fees exist to begin with, they are the result of crowded block area. Congestion is present in a blockchain context as the basic security style of blockchains demands that customers can individually audit and verify the transactional background from the 1st block should they elect to, and theres a limitation to the amount of data which can be audited per unit period.
A blockchain is really a replicated ledger. The orthodox safety model requires that customers have the ability to actually run an ongoing version of this ledger, and recreate and validate all historical dealings, thereby making certain the rules are increasingly being followed. Bitcoins style philosophy aims allowing anyone with at the very least a weak web connection and consumer-grade equipment to perform a complete audit of the deal log.
Ethereum requires a more liberal method, adding computational complexity plus some scalability at the expense of more challenging and costly verification. But still, operating an Ethereum node ought to be doable on high-finish consumer hardware if customers discard some historical info after validating it, a method called pruning. It isn’t out of the achieve of a fairly technical personal with a modest spending budget.
The look philosophy of both Bitcoin and Ethereum (at the very least in its present type founder Vitalik Buterin provides more ambitious programs which deviate out of this idea) stresses the significance of an individual having the ability to run an ongoing duplicate of the ledger. For that reason, the development of the ledger must itself end up being constrained to keep the price of node procedure within affordable bounds. The main constraints are usually disk i/o, bandwidth and storage space capacity.
Its insufficient to shop the blockchain you need to stay up-to-date using its latest entries, this means downloading plenty of information and performing brand-new computation by verifying information since it arrives. Here’s where we reach the main element constraints: Theres only therefore much computation modern equipment is capable of doing per unit time just so many signatures which can be verified and state adjustments verified. Needless to say, node software can (and contains already been) optimized, to eke even more computation (and therefore transactional validation) from the same amount of bit flips. Storage space and bandwidth are usually becoming cheaper as time passes, too. But these nevertheless represent authentic constraints grounded in the laws and regulations of physics. Some type of computer can only achieve this much.
So, we reach the standing quo. Bitcoins protocol provides a theoretical optimum of 4 MB of new block room every 10 minutes used, this hovers around 1.2 MB at the existing weekly typical. Ethereum post-EIP-1559 creates approximately 6 MB every 10 minutes. If need exceeds offer, a queue emerges, and the best bidders get priority usage of block space. Hence, costs.
As demonstrated, fees aren’t a PoW factor or a power thing. They’re a security model issue. In order to keep carefully the decentralization high, you need to keep carefully the price of node operation reduced, and therefore you wish to limit the number of information a validator must procedure per unit time. Should you choose most of these things, as well as your blockchain is well-known, costs will organically emerge, because they do in Bitcoin and Ethereum.
Now, invest the a much looser see of safety, and you also are content to truly have a small number of really performant nodes carrying out all the validation, then you can certainly create more block room, and drive fees successfully to zero.
This is simply not a fresh idea; its the building blocks of the large block motion in Bitcoin, which embroiled the process in a civil battle for the higher part of ten years. That motion gave birth to an ideal counterexample to the statements of FTX: BSV.
The creative designers of BSV developed virtually-unlimited levels of blockspace, content because they were to truly have a small number of commercial nodes perform validation. Charges are efficiently zero in BSV. But it is a PoW system, and its own miners absolutely consume power. Conversely, at some time next 12 months, Ethereum will proceed to a proof-of-stake design, at which point it’ll stop consuming meaningful levels of power. But I anticipate Ethereum will nevertheless having meaningful costs at the bottom layer and these costs will undoubtedly be considered desirable in lots of respects, since they assistance the deflationary system introduced with EIP-1559.
The reason why that Solana, for example, has low costs, is merely because the creative designers of this network were pleased to adopt another security design from Bitcoin or Ethereum. In Solana, there’s without any difference between owning a node for the reasons of verifying the integrity of the chain and owning a node for mining blocks. Therefore, owning a Solana node needs incredibly specialized hardware and a skilled devops team.
We are able to verify this, as Coin Metrics works one (alongside 100 some other nodes spanning 25 distinct Coating 1 blockchains). It expenses Coin Metrics a large number of thousands of bucks a month to perform a SOL node. That is clearly a magnitude greater than the few of a huge selection of dollars per month we spend operating BTC nodes.
At current prices, Solana produces approximately 550-instances even more blockspace than Bitcoin each day. Solana validators, at present rates, must procedure around 100 GB each day of information, or 36 TB each year. Most of that information is taken out, or pruned, which impacts the power of third events to check all dealings from genesis.
Bitcoin node operators, in comparison, ingest around 180 MB each day, or 65 GB each year. Solana validators must as a result manage two orders of magnitude even more information than Bitcoin validators. Ethereum is really a bit more complicated and computationally intensive than Bitcoin, but nonetheless far more restricted than Solana with regards to the computational function validators must do to keep the ledger.
Solana can provide users even more abundant blockspace and for that reason a cheaper all-in transactional encounter, but this arrives at a price. The network has skilled outages, as its fairly few nodes were effectively targeted with DDoS episodes. Efficiently, Solana obtained (a way of measuring) scalability, but at the expense of even more centralization, and consequent fragility.
Ultimately, the Sybil-resistance system used is basically irrelevant to the issue of charges. A PoS system could be totally costless from a power viewpoint and constrict block room, causing charges to emerge; a PoW system could raise blockspace and drive costs to zero.
Heavy MAY BE THE Mind That Wears The Crown
While FTXs evaluation is off bottom on the issue of costs and PoW, we are able to even so sympathize with the wish of an swap operator to align itself with proof-of-stake networks, also to minimize the significance of PoW networks.
In the end, when you can influence the planet toward an outcome where PoS-based monetary goods are usually dominant, and you also run a big custodial swap which stands to build up plenty of those PoS resources, your incentives are obvious. Other activities being equal, you almost certainly prefer to have significantly more instead of less influence on the worlds future financial process.
In a PoS-dominant planet, trade operators, custodians and banking institutions that accumulate probably the most coins are usually king. Customers that deposit coins usually surrender their coin-based system voting privileges to the exchanges themselves. You can find already types of exchanges used to impact PoS systems, as happened when Justin Sunlight colluded with Binance, Huobi and Poloniex to commandeer the Steem system. These exchanges voted with consumer money in Suns favor, demonstrating a clear principal-agent problem developed by the custody of PoS resources.
In a PoW globe, large intermediaries are significantly less empowered. The failing of SegWit2x, a motion supported by the majority of the big exchanges and custodians at that time, demonstrates this. Imagine an identical movement today, except occurring on one of the bigger PoS networks. The biggest exchange operators, custodying because they do a big plurality of all outstanding coins, would basically shape the protocol with their liking with no level of resistance.
And in a global where operating an swap is really a decidedly hazardous occupation, as demonstrated by the travails of BitMEX, Huobi and OKEx executives, the inclination is usually certainly to offend the powers that end up being as little as feasible.
So, it stands to cause that FTX leadership would align itself with ecological PoS, eliminating what offers historically been probably the most strident objection to open public blockchains from the plan group. Why rock a boat that is already swaying very precariously?
But we’d argue that despite the fact that the naive analysis shows that exchanges should, as an organization, assistance and foster the development of PoS while marginalizing PoW, that is unwise over time. If these exchanges/brokerages/banks accumulate a big fraction of all coins, they’ll amass enormous political energy, particularly if these blockchains turn out to be financial assets of worldwide consequence. At that time, accumulating voting energy proportional to coins kept will become a poisoned chalice. The swap will become a gigantic honeypot for hawaii a state that will not surrender its energy of sanctions easily.
Once we transition from the world where in fact the U.S. tasks power through correspondent banking institutions and international techniques like SWIFT, to an environment of stablecoins, MetaMasks and Layer 2 protocols, hawaii will need to develop new methods to control economic flows. It will be easy in the extreme in case a small couple of exchanges accumulated a big portion of source in PoS systems, and submitted (because they ultimately must and can) to significantly onerous regulation.
At this stage, exchanges would just become deputized in the same way banks are nowadays into undertaking state policy, that could properly extend to controlling open public blockchains at the process layer. PoS systems explicitly grant handle and discretion to the biggest stakeholders, therefore at this time, the jig will be up. The condition would be absolve to go after its merry ambitions of serious economic deplatforming.
This isnt simply fantasy. Currently, the U.S. monetary policy establishment is challenging that stablecoins acquire federal bank charters, which may bring issuers directly beneath the aegis of the Federal government Deposit Insurance Company (FDIC), any office of the Comptroller of the Foreign currency (OCC) and the Government Reserve. The exchanges, presently loosely regulated in the U.S. under a patchwork of state-by-state regulations, will furthermore be asked to publish to federal government regulation.
So, the swap CEOs that lionize purportedly ecological PoS and dismiss the merits of PoW ought to be cautious what they want. It may seem interesting on a surface area level to regulate consensus from the chair of a big custodial exchange, nonetheless it is really a power that’s best spurned to begin with.
General public blockchains exist to get rid of centralized points of handle and to take away the political constraints which are inherent in conventional finance. The mix of PoS and huge quantities of coins kept in regulated exchanges or banking institutions is one that is quite conducive to hawaii reasserting control of these nominally-decentralized systems. If you don’t are wanting to be deputized right into a hall keep track of for the brand new financial program, it is advisable to repudiate the impact that helming a PoS system would grant you.
It is a guest post by Nic Carter and Lucas Nuzzi. Opinions expressed are completely their very own and do not always reflect those of BTC Inc or Bitcoin Magazine.